January Weather in Juba, South Sudan

Last updated: August 31, 2025

In January, the average temperature in Juba, South Sudan reaches a warm 30°C (87°F), with minimum temperatures dipping to 20°C (69°F) and soaring to a maximum of 40°C (105°F). Luckily, the region experiences just 2 mm (0.1 in) of precipitation over 0 days, making it a perfect time to enjoy the weather. With an average humidity of 48%, the climate remains comfortable and inviting.

How January Weather in Juba Compares to Other Months

Weather in Juba var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ares January’s weather to other months in Juba,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in Juba, showing how January’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ather30°C (87°F)2 mm (0.1 inches)48%extreme
February Weather31°C (88°F)4 mm (0.2 inches)35%extreme
March Weather31°C (89°F)17 mm (0.7 inches)37%extreme
April Weather30°C (86°F)73 mm (2.9 inches)57%extreme
May Weather28°C (83°F)128 mm (5.1 inches)79%extreme
June Weather27°C (80°F)135 mm (5.3 inches)82%extreme
July Weather26°C (79°F)121 mm (4.8 inches)85%extreme
August Weather26°C (79°F)125 mm (4.9 inches)87%extreme
September Weather26°C (79°F)122 mm (4.8 inches)87%extreme
October Weather26°C (80°F)150 mm (5.9 inches)89%extreme
November Weather28°C (83°F)37 mm (1.5 inches)88%extreme
December Weather29°C (85°F)6 mm (0.2 inches)81%very high
